Transaction 43fd3a023918cecdf3207d2b6154edf79cb8b622348f2387750b08d00cb71270

1 Input
2 Outputs
  • 43fd3a023918cecdf3207d2b6154edf79cb8b622348f2387750b08d00cb71270:0
  • value  627231591
    address  15R3xrmmEr5SMsApmhJj1niq4wjiwMwkRT
  • 43fd3a023918cecdf3207d2b6154edf79cb8b622348f2387750b08d00cb71270:1
  • value  600000
    address  1Lb58xgCrTTVu2znfuEQyQ4hWjpRPqrzsk